Cells derived from the mesoderm, which lies between the endoderm and the ectoderm, give rise to all other tissues of the body, including the dermis of the skin, the heart, the muscle system, the urogenital system, the bones, and the bone marrow (and therefore the blood). Endoderm is the innermost of the three primary germ layers in the very early embryo.The other two layers are the ectoderm (outside layer) and mesoderm (middle layer), with the endoderm being the innermost layer. In many fish, pharyngeal teeth develop deep in the pharynx in an area of endoderm, although it has not been proved that the epithelium of these teeth is derived exclusively from the endoderm (Huysseune et al., 2010). This has particularly affected the differentiation of hESC towards definitive endoderm (DE) and its derivatives, mostly due to the overlap of gene expression patterns between DE and extraembryonic endoderm and the following lack of specific markers for early definitive endoderm (Pera et al., 2004). Mesoderm initially forms a multilayered cellular layer separating ectoderm and endoderm, mesoderm also lies outside the embryo as extra-embryonic mesoderm (covered in placenta lecture). In anatomy, the notochord is a flexible rod formed of a material similar to cartilage.If a species has a notochord at any stage of its life cycle, it is, by definition, a chordate.The notochord lies along the anteroposterior axis (front to back), is usually closer to the dorsal than the ventral surface of the embryo, and is composed of cells derived from the mesoderm.
